What is it like to work at Dominium?

Dominium is a multifamily property management company that values a collaborative and customer-focused work environment, prioritizing teamwork and open communication among its employees.

The company's structure is divided into various departments, including property management, accounting, and maintenance, allowing employees to specialize in their areas of interest and contribute to the overall success of the organization. Dominium's mission is to provide high-quality living experiences for its residents while fostering a positive and inclusive work culture.

Working at Dominium may appeal to individuals who are passionate about real estate, customer service, and community development, as the company offers opportunities for professional growth, competitive compensation, and a sense of fulfillment that comes from making a positive impact on people's lives.

Job description

Description

Dominium is helping tackle the affordable housing crisis - and we're looking for motivated candidates to join our team and advance our mission. With offices in Atlanta, Dallas, Phoenix and Minneapolis, Dominium is one of the nation's most respected and innovative affordable housing development and management companies. We create quality, affordable homes and engage with our residents to foster a strong sense of community and connection.

Join us in making a difference in people's lives every day at a company where you can challenge yourself to develop both personally and professionally.

We are currently seeking an Assistant Manager to join our team at Juniper Square, a 221 unit apartment community in Glendale, AZ.

Position Summary:

As an Assistant Manager, you will be responsible for supporting the Community Manager with the daily operations of the property.

Responsibilities:

  • Maintain stable occupancy and meet budgeted financial goals
  • Build strong resident relations and provide excellent customer service
  • Assist the Community Manager to train, direct, motivate, and assist site personnel
  • Establish positive relationships within the community
  • Be on-call as scheduled by management

Qualifications:

  • 1 - 2 years previous property management experience preferred
  • Section 8, Section 42, and/or Market Rate experience preferred
  • Yardi software experience preferred
  • Ability to work occasional evenings and weekends as needed

About Us: Dominium is a purpose-driven leader in affordable housing. We operate in approximately 20 states, supported by a team of over 1,300 dedicated employees. For more than 50 years, we have delivered excellence in the development and management of affordable housing communities across the United States. Dominium's values - EDGE: Entrepreneurial Innovation, Developing People, Growth Mindset and Execution - guide us in fulfilling our Purpose: to provide quality, affordable housing that builds Enduring Value for our residents, employees, communities and financial partners. We believe housing provides dignity, and our work has a positive, lasting impact on the lives of individuals and families - often for generations. Our properties last for decades, leaving a lasting impact in the communities where they are located.
